Unmanaged conflict has caused many hardships in the workplace and at home. It can cause people to suffer, missions to fail, and families to seperate. yet, conflict is inevitable. This workshop helps people manage conflict by examining their attitudes and behaviors when faced with conflicting situations. Practicing skills that prevent conflict from escalations, and working with others to solve problems. This allows people to grow, missions to succeed, and families to strengthen.
